CLEVELAND – PolyOne Corporation (NYSE: POL) a premier global provider of specialized polymer materials, services and solutions, today announced the launch of UltraTuf™ SG sheet, a tough, weather-resistant thermoforming sheet for signage and glazing applications.
The sign industry is a key segment for PolyOne, and UltraTuf SG sheet is a valuable addition to our portfolio,” said Kendall Justiniano, marketing director, custom engineered solutions, Designed Structures and Solutions at PolyOne.
UltraTuf SG sheet also provides superior heat resistance and ease of fabrication for enhanced design flexibility.

Predictive simulation technology uses conventional (isotropic) and advanced (anisotropic) modeling data from material characterizations, mold filling analysis, and finite element analysis (FEA) to more accurately forecast performance and potential failure points.
By factoring in static and dynamic data, the CAE simulations can identify where an injection molded plastic part may crack or break when exposed to real-world conditions such as physical loading force, sudden impact (crash simulation), or environmental factors like temperature and humidity.
